Adds a fake MacOS-style bar to websites. Useful for screenshots.
Fake MacOS Bar – Clean UI Screenshots for Frontend Developers This Chrome extension adds a classic MacOS-style top bar to any website, making it perfect for taking clean UI screenshots of your frontend projects. It pushes content down so nothing overlaps, ensuring your design looks professional. Features: ✅ MacOS-style bar with traffic light buttons (red, yellow, green). ✅ Pushes the page down so the bar sits naturally on top. ✅ Toggle on/off easily with a slider. Ideal for frontend developers, designers, and product showcases. No more cropping browser UI—just clean, professional-looking screenshots of your work.
